Rhinoplasty is a plastic surgery that is performed to correct the shape of the nose or imperfections like a bump or a nasal septum. It can be a common solution for both who want a different cosmetic look and have nasal problems. Rhinoplasty changes your look for better to make you look beautiful and feel confident about yourself. Contours of your nose and face look firm. Most people are pleased with the outcome of Rhinoplasty and this is obvious because it is the fourth most common surgery performed today. It also helps to correct breathing problems like snoring, sleep apnea etc. If a nose job turns out successful it will fit your face and look naturally perfect.

Despite being on one the most commercially viable medical techniques to reshape your nose, this is a tricky process where the doctor needs to understand certain things before committing a Rhinoplasty on the patient. The complete medical history of the patient is studied, including the family history of any ailments, past surgeries, reaction to drugs, allergies, physical and mental fitness. The patient’s problem should be well understood by the doctor.
